Skip to main content

Was ist ein Arduino Ide?

The Arduino Integrierte Entwicklungsumgebung (IDE), auch bekannt als Arduino Entwicklungsumgebung ist ein Programm, das es einfacher macht, Software für diese Open -Source -Plattform zu schreiben.Der Arduino Platform ist eine beliebte Elektronikplattform, die den Prozess des Entwerfens elektronischer Geräte vereinfacht.Zu den gemeinsamen Verwendungen für IT gehören Robotik, Technologie zur Hausverbesserung, tragbare Computer und Neuheitenelektronikanwendungen.Die meisten Arduino Erfindungen werden unter Verwendung des Arduino IDE.

IDEs werden üblicherweise von Programmierern verwendet, um den Programmprozess zu beschleunigen.Zu den allgemeinen IDE -Funktionen gehören die automatische Zeilennummerierung, das Hervorheben der Syntax und die integrierte Kompilierung.Während es technisch gesehen möglich ist, Software nur mit einem einfachen Texteditor zu schreiben, ist der Prozess beim Schreiben von Code in einer IDE viel einfacher.Viele Programmiersprachen haben ihre eigenen IDEs, und es wurden mehrere Allzweck -IDes entwickelt.Diese Allzweck -IDEs können mit einer Vielzahl von unterstützten Programmiersprachen verwendet werden.

ARDUINO REG;IDE bietet eine Umgebung, in der Programmierer ein einzelnes Programm von Anfang bis Ende verwenden können.Es kann mehrere Dateien in einem Projekt verfolgen, sodass Programmierer komplexere oder modulare Programme zum Verwalten ihrer Projekte schreiben können.Die IDE kompiliert auch Code selbst, führt grundlegendes Debuggen durch und überträgt den Code direkt an den Arduino Vorstand, das dann den Arduino Bootloader zum Schreiben des neuen Programms in den Speicher.IDE ist im Vergleich zu anderen, fortgeschritteneren IDEs mangelhaft.Dies liegt daran, dass es mehrere gängige Funktionen fehlen, einschließlich der automatischen sichtbaren Zeilennummerierung, mit der Programmierer bei der Bewertung von Fehlermeldungen oder der Kommunikation mit anderen Programmierern problemlos auf bestimmte Abschnitte des Quellcodes verweisen können.Weitere fehlende Funktionen sind detaillierte Fehlermeldungen, die für die Diagnose und Behebung eines Codierungsfehlers und der Codesfaltung nützlich sind, mit denen Programmierer nur relevante Teile des Quellcodes untersuchen können, indem Pars versteckt werden, die nicht von den jüngsten Änderungen betroffen sind.Bearbeiten Sie diese Einschränkungen, einige Arduino Programmierer verwenden andere IDEs, um Programme zu schreiben.Diese Benutzer haben Software -Plugins für Allzweck -IDEs geschrieben, die Unterstützung für Arduino reg;Spezifische Programmierung.Dies fügt viele der Funktionen hinzu, die Programmierer im Arduino IDE, aber die Lösung hat auch mehrere Einschränkungen.Um die Möglichkeit zu erhalten, generische IDEs für Arduino Code, Programmierer müssen ihre Plugins routinemäßig mit jeder neuen Version von Arduino Reg aktualisieren.Software.Darüber hinaus können diese generischen IDEs nicht mit Arduino reg zusammenhängen;Boards, und daher können daher nicht verwendet werden, um ausgefüllte Software in einen Arduino reg;Erfindung.